1998 Chrysler Grand Voyager vs. 2008 Panoz Esperante

To start off, 2008 Panoz Esperante is newer by 10 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1998 Chrysler Grand Voyager.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1998 Chrysler Grand Voyager would be higher. At 4,589 cc (8 cylinders), 2008 Panoz Esperante is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Panoz Esperante (305 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 157 more horse power than 1998 Chrysler Grand Voyager. (148 HP @ 5200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2008 Panoz Esperante should accelerate faster than 1998 Chrysler Grand Voyager.

Because 2008 Panoz Esperante is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2008 Panoz Esperante.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1998 Chrysler Grand Voyager,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Panoz Esperante (434 Nm @ 4200 RPM) has 207 more torque (in Nm) than 1998 Chrysler Grand Voyager. (227 Nm @ 3900 RPM). This means 2008 Panoz Esperante will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1998 Chrysler Grand Voyager.

Compare all specifications:

1998 Chrysler Grand Voyager 2008 Panoz Esperante
Make Chrysler Panoz
Model Grand Voyager Esperante
Year Released 1998 2008
Body Type Minivan Convertible
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2428 cc 4589 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 148 HP 305 HP
Engine RPM 5200 RPM 5800 RPM
Torque 227 Nm 434 Nm
Torque RPM 3900 RPM 4200 RPM
Engine Bore Size 87.5 mm 90.2 mm
Engine Stroke Size 101 mm 90 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 9.4:1 9.8:1
Drive Type Front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Vehicle Length 5080 mm 4480 mm
Vehicle Width 1960 mm 1870 mm
Vehicle Height 1800 mm 1360 mm
Wheelbase Size 3040 mm 2700 mm
